Output 85b3d680a287a44f5e8a122f8108279021fb4a0caa55323734b24ac0ca9e9717:1

value
11352705
script pubkey
OP_HASH160 OP_PUSHBYTES_20 4018ea9f2bbf2990c6d5d520016ae0733d92ba66 OP_EQUAL
address
37Xw23oJYLEXPrf5JJBaHaWPA86YMnPd2D
transaction
85b3d680a287a44f5e8a122f8108279021fb4a0caa55323734b24ac0ca9e9717
spent
true